How do you convert $ 50\% $ into a fraction in the simplest form?

Hint: First for the question to be solved remember that whenever in a question there is talk about percentage that it is taken out of hundred . so whenever someone says that something is $ x\% $ it means that the amount is $ x $ out of $ 100 $ . Also when a fraction is asked to be written as the simplest fraction the numerator and denominator are cancelled with each other to the point where there are not any common factors left between the numerator and denominator. Thus when $ 50\% $ is asked we write the fraction of it as,
$ \dfrac{{50}}{{100}} $
And we will cancel it to achieve the final answer.
Complete step by step solution:
The given question asks us to find the simplest fraction first we will write the percentage in the fraction form. The percentage to fraction conversion becomes
$ \dfrac{{50}}{{100}} $
Upon solving it further and dividing both the numerator and denominator by $ 50 $ we get,
$\Rightarrow \dfrac{1}{2} $
Which is our final answer. Thus we have expressed the given percentage in the fraction form with the simplest fraction.
So, the correct answer is “ $ \dfrac{1}{2} $ ”.
Note: Whenever percentage is written divide the given amount of percentage by the number $ 100 $ . So if a given percentage $ x $ is given we can write the fraction as,
$ \dfrac{x}{{100}} $ . The percent word in itself means “per” “cent” which means per hundred and hence the number $ 100 $ . When the simplest fraction is asked just keep on cancelling the numerator and denominator with each other, until the simplest form of the fraction is reached where they could not cancel each other any further.
